[Mobilizon] A federated organization and mobilization platform

#Mobilizon for #Yunohost has been released 0.1.0-2019-04-24

#Mobilizon is a federated organization and mobilization platform supported by @Framasoft@framapiaf.org

Mobilizon is actually under development. The release provided is an early early early early alpha. Like very early…

This package has been created to let you discover and involve in #Mobilizon project.

More informations at https://joinmobilizon.org

Install with the following command:

$ yunohost app install GitHub - YunoHost-Apps/mobilizon_ynh: A federated organization and mobilization platform for YunoHost<


in graphical install some wrong and let url set to /

this is error log that say / already in use install failure logs

does need only one app for use mobillizon ?
what is understood ? where we normaly set the url ?

Salut Tonton,

Est ce que tu parles français? En anglais je ne comprends pas trop ton problème…

oui je domine en français ! o)
l’install plante depuis l’interface graphique. Comme tu peut le voir sur la capture d’ecran il est proposé un select avec understood là ou on indique le chemin de l’appli /pad pour etherpad par exemple. Et aucun autre choix et on sait pas bien d’ou sort ce understood.
en lisant les code d’erreur l’install est proposé avec l’url /
comme ça
2019-07-17 16:33:52,839: DEBUG - + trap ynh_exit_properly EXIT
2019-07-17 16:33:52,839: DEBUG - + domain=laruche118.ynh.fr
2019-07-17 16:33:52,839: DEBUG - + path_url=/
ou 2019-07-17 16:33:53,051: DEBUG - + ynh_webpath_register --app=mobilizon --domain=laruche118.ynh.fr --path_url=/
puis ensuite
2019-07-17 16:33:53,252: WARNING - Cette URL n’est pas disponible ou est en conflit avec une application existante :
2019-07-17 16:33:53,253: DEBUG - + local exit_code=1
donc l’install en ligne de commande permet peut être de preciser le /app_path utile pour differencier les chemin de chaque app.

PFFF i read readme on github !!!
we need special domain name for this app !!
so i let create one and retry install !

J’ai également un souci à l’installation :
(attention gros pavé :face_with_monocle:)

Sinon peut-être est-ce ça le problème ?

DEBUG - Generated mobilizon app
2019-07-18 11:56:45,232: DEBUG - 
2019-07-18 11:56:45,232: WARNING - ** (Postgrex.Error) ERROR 58P01 (undefined_file) could not open extension control file "/usr/share/postgresql/9.6/extension/postgis.control": No such file or directory
2019-07-18 11:56:45,234: DEBUG - 
2019-07-18 11:56:45,234: WARNING -     (ecto_sql) lib/ecto/adapters/sql.ex:621: Ecto.Adapters.SQL.raise_sql_call_error/1
2019-07-18 11:56:45,234: DEBUG -     #########################################################
2019-07-18 11:56:45,235: WARNING -     (elixir) lib/enum.ex:1336: Enum."-map/2-lists^map/1-0-"/2
2019-07-18 11:56:45,235: DEBUG -     # If the CREATE EXTENSION or DROP EXTENSION calls fail, #
2019-07-18 11:56:45,235: WARNING -     (ecto_sql) lib/ecto/adapters/sql.ex:708: Ecto.Adapters.SQL.execute_ddl/4
2019-07-18 11:56:45,236: DEBUG -     # please manually execute them with an authorized       #
2019-07-18 11:56:45,236: WARNING -     (ecto_sql) lib/ecto/migration/runner.ex:340: Ecto.Migration.Runner.log_and_execute_ddl/3
2019-07-18 11:56:45,236: DEBUG -     # PostgreSQL user with SUPER USER role.                 #
2019-07-18 11:56:45,236: WARNING -     (ecto_sql) lib/ecto/migration/runner.ex:119: anonymous fn/6 in Ecto.Migration.Runner.flush/0
2019-07-18 11:56:45,237: DEBUG -     #########################################################
2019-07-18 11:56:45,237: WARNING -     (elixir) lib/enum.ex:1948: Enum."-reduce/3-lists^foldl/2-0-"/3
2019-07-18 11:56:45,237: DEBUG - 
2019-07-18 11:56:45,237: WARNING -     (ecto_sql) lib/ecto/migration/runner.ex:118: Ecto.Migration.Runner.flush/0
2019-07-18 11:56:45,238: DEBUG - 
2019-07-18 11:56:45,238: WARNING -     (stdlib) timer.erl:166: :timer.tc/1
2019-07-18 11:56:45,238: DEBUG - 
2019-07-18 11:56:45,238: DEBUG - 
2019-07-18 11:56:45,239: DEBUG - 11:56:45.184 [info]  == Running 20180109150000 Mobilizon.Repo.Migrations.Prerequites.up/0 forward
2019-07-18 11:56:45,239: DEBUG - 
2019-07-18 11:56:45,239: DEBUG - 11:56:45.184 [info]  execute "CREATE TYPE datetimetz AS (\n    dt timestamptz,\n    tz varchar\n);\n"
2019-07-18 11:56:45,239: DEBUG - 
2019-07-18 11:56:45,239: DEBUG - 11:56:45.186 [info]  execute "CREATE EXTENSION IF NOT EXISTS postgis"
2019-07-18 11:56:45,239: DEBUG - + ynh_exit_properly
2019-07-18 11:56:45,239: DEBUG - + local exit_code=1
2019-07-18 11:56:45,239: DEBUG - + '[' 1 -eq 0 ']'
2019-07-18 11:56:45,240: DEBUG - + trap '' EXIT
2019-07-18 11:56:45,240: DEBUG - + set +eu

Ouaip, on dirait que l’extension postgis a postgresl ne s’installe pas sur ton YunoHost. J’ai fait plusieurs testes de mon coté sans rencontrer de problémes d’installation.

Aprés ce package est plutot destiné à des personnes qui voudrait essayer Mobilizon pour y contribuer, l’application ne fonctionne pas encore…

1 Like

On va dire que c’était ma contribution :wink:

c’était juste par curiosité… je vais attendre encore un peut.

#Mobilizon for #YunoHost has been upgraded to 0.1.0-2019-07-28

#Mobilizon is a federated organization and mobilization platform supported by @Framasoft@framapiaf.org

Mobilizon is actually under development. The release provided is an early early early early alpha. Like very early…

This package has been created to let you discover and involve in #Mobilizon project.

More informations at https://joinmobilizon.org


  • Add tiptap editor for description
  • Attach actor to pictures entity
  • Allow removing files
  • Improved event form creation date & timepickers
  • Identity creation/update
  • Fix 404s on RSS feeds
  • Introduce backend for reports
  • Add link to event and group creation on dashboard
  • Refactor adding tags to an event

Upgrade with the following command:

$ y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h

1 Like

pour info
j’ai une version precedente (sans post) mais à l’update
$ y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h

nnpm ERR! A complete log of this run can be found in:
Attention : npm ERR!     /var/www/mobilizon/.npm/_logs/2019-08-28T21_36_50_112Z-debug.log
Attention : [ERR] !!
Attention :   mobilizon's script has encountered an error. Its execution was cancelled.
Attention : !!
Attention : Please find here an extract of the log before the crash:
Attention : **[DEBUG]: DEBUG   -  error  in /var/www/mobilizon/mobilizon/js/src/views/User/PasswordReset.vue**
Attention : [DEBUG]: DEBUG   -
Attention : [DEBUG]: DEBUG   - ERROR in /var/www/mobilizon/mobilizon/js/src/views/User/PasswordReset.vue
Attention : [DEBUG]: DEBUG   - 82:20 Object is possibly 'null' or 'undefined'.
Attention : [DEBUG]: DEBUG   -     80 |       });
Attention : [DEBUG]: DEBUG   -     81 |
Attention : [DEBUG]: DEBUG   -   > 82 |       saveUserData(result.data.resetPassword);
Attention : [DEBUG]: DEBUG   -        |                    ^
Attention : [DEBUG]: DEBUG   -     83 |       this.$router.push({ name: RouteName.HOME });
Attention : [DEBUG]: DEBUG   -     84 |     } catch (err) {
Attention : [DEBUG]: DEBUG   -     85 |       console.error(err);
Attention : [DEBUG]: DEBUG   -
Attention : [DEBUG]: DEBUG   - Webpack Bundle Analyzer saved report to /var/www/mobilizon/mobilizon/priv/static/report.html
Attention : [DEBUG]: WARNING -  ERROR  Build failed with errors.
Attention : [DEBUG]: WARNING - npm ERR! code ELIFECYCLE
Attention : [DEBUG]: WARNING - npm ERR! errno 1
Attention : [DEBUG]: WARNING - npm ERR! mobilizon@0.1.0 build: `vue-cli-service build`
Attention : [DEBUG]: WARNING - npm ERR! Exit status 1pm ERR! A complete log of this run can be found in:
Attention : npm ERR!     /var/www/mobilizon/.npm/_logs/2019-08-28T21_36_50_112Z-debug.log
Attention : [ERR] !!
Attention :   mobilizon's script has encountered an error. Its execution was cancelled.
Attention : !!
Attention : Please find here an extract of the log before the crash:
Attention : [DEBUG]: DEBUG   -  error  in /var/www/mobilizon/mobilizon/js/src/views/User/PasswordReset.vue
Attention : [DEBUG]: DEBUG   -
Attention : [DEBUG]: DEBUG   - ERROR in /var/www/mobilizon/mobilizon/js/src/views/User/PasswordReset.vue
Attention : [DEBUG]: DEBUG   - 82:20 Object is possibly 'null' or 'undefined'.
Attention : [DEBUG]: DEBUG   -     80 |       });
Attention : [DEBUG]: DEBUG   -     81 |
Attention : [DEBUG]: DEBUG   -   > 82 |       saveUserData(result.data.resetPassword);
Attention : [DEBUG]: DEBUG   -        |                    ^
Attention : [DEBUG]: DEBUG   -     83 |       this.$router.push({ name: RouteName.HOME });
Attention : [DEBUG]: DEBUG   -     84 |     } catch (err) {
Attention : [DEBUG]: DEBUG   -     85 |       console.error(err);
Attention : [DEBUG]: DEBUG   -
Attention : [DEBUG]: DEBUG   - Webpack Bundle Analyzer saved report to /var/www/mobilizon/mobilizon/priv/static/report.html
Attention : [DEBUG]: WARNING -  ERROR  Build failed with errors.
Attention : [DEBUG]: WARNING - npm ERR! code ELIFECYCLE
Attention : [DEBUG]: WARNING - npm ERR! errno 1
Attention : [DEBUG]: WARNING - npm ERR! mobilizon@0.1.0 build: `vue-cli-service build`
Attention : [DEBUG]: WARNING - npm ERR! Exit status 1

est ce que tu peux faire la commande: y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h --debug et fournir le lien vers le yunopaste des logs complets

a la suitede la commande précedente l’appli n’etait plus installé…
y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h

Du coup l’install graphique à fonctionnée.

#Mobilizon for #YunoHost has been upgraded to 0.1.0-2019-10-10

#Mobilizon is a federated organization and mobilization platform supported by @Framasoft@framapiaf.org

Mobilizon is actually under development. The release provided is an early early early early alpha. Like very early…

This package has been created to let you discover and involve in #Mobilizon project.

More informations at https://joinmobilizon.org

Upgrade with the following command:

$ y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h

Ça semble être le même problème de mon côté

Warning: ** (Postgrex.Error) ERROR 58P01 (undefined_file) could not open extension control file "/usr/share/postgresql/9.6/extension/postgis.control": No such file or directory
Warning:     (ecto_sql) lib/ecto/adapters/sql.ex:621: Ecto.Adapters.SQL.raise_sql_call_error/1
Warning:     (elixir) lib/enum.ex:1336: Enum."-map/2-lists^map/1-0-"/2
Warning:     (ecto_sql) lib/ecto/adapters/sql.ex:708: Ecto.Adapters.SQL.execute_ddl/4
Warning:     (ecto_sql) lib/ecto/migration/runner.ex:340: Ecto.Migration.Runner.log_and_execute_ddl/3
Warning:     (ecto_sql) lib/ecto/migration/runner.ex:119: anonymous fn/6 in Ecto.Migration.Runner.flush/0
Warning:     (elixir) lib/enum.ex:1948: Enum."-reduce/3-lists^foldl/2-0-"/3
Warning:     (ecto_sql) lib/ecto/migration/runner.ex:118: Ecto.Migration.Runner.flush/0
Warning:     (stdlib) timer.erl:166: :timer.tc/1
Warning: [ERR] !!
Warning:   mobilizon's script has encountered an error. Its execution was cancelled.
Warning: !!
Warning: Please find here an extract of the log before the crash:
Warning: [DEBUG]: WARNING - ** (Postgrex.Error) ERROR 58P01 (undefined_file) could not open extension control file "/usr/share/postgresql/9.6/extension/postgis.control": No such file or directory
Warning: [DEBUG]: WARNING -     (ecto_sql) lib/ecto/adapters/sql.ex:621: Ecto.Adapters.SQL.raise_sql_call_error/1
Warning: [DEBUG]: WARNING -     (elixir) lib/enum.ex:1336: Enum."-map/2-lists^map/1-0-"/2
Warning: [DEBUG]: WARNING -     (ecto_sql) lib/ecto/adapters/sql.ex:708: Ecto.Adapters.SQL.execute_ddl/4
Warning: [DEBUG]: WARNING -     (ecto_sql) lib/ecto/migration/runner.ex:340: Ecto.Migration.Runner.log_and_execute_ddl/3
Warning: [DEBUG]: WARNING -     (ecto_sql) lib/ecto/migration/runner.ex:119: anonymous fn/6 in Ecto.Migration.Runner.flush/0
Warning: [DEBUG]: DEBUG   - + ynh_exit_properly
Info: The operation 'Install 'mobilizon' application' has failed! To get help, please share the full log of this operation using the command 'yunohost log display 20191115-042522-app_install-mobilizon --share'
Info: Loading installation settings...
Info: Stopping and removing the systemd service
Info: Removing the PostgreSQL database
Warning: FATAL:  terminating connection due to administrator command
Warning: server closed the connection unexpectedly
Warning: 	This probably means the server terminated abnormally
Warning: 	before or while processing the request.
Warning: connection to server was lost
Info: Removing dependencies
Info: Removing app main directory
Info: Removing nginx web server configuration
Info: Closing a port...
Warning: [WARN] Avoid deleting /var/log/mobilizon/.
Info: Removing the dedicated system user
Info: Removal of mobilizon completed

Je venais même de faire la dernière mise à jour Postgres…

#Mobilizon for #YunoHost has been upgraded to 0.1.0-2019-12-28

#Mobilizon is a federated organization and mobilization platform supported by @Framasoft@framapiaf.org

Mobilizon is actually under development. The release provided is the 1.0.0-beta.2 + few commits.

This package has been created to let you discover and involve in #Mobilizon project.

More informations at https://joinmobilizon.org

Upgrade with the following command:

$ yunohost app upgrade mobilizon -u https://github.com/YunoHost-Apps/mobilizon_ynh

1 Like

je ne reçois l email pour confirmer l account
NOQUEUE: reject: RCPT from localhost[] yunohost
il est rejeté

suis je le seul ?


J’ai le même souci que @philko : je ne reçoit pas le mail de confirmation. Comme je suis censé être l’admin de mon instance, c’est un peu embettant. Je ne peux donc pas l’utiliser. Je viens de créer un post pour mon problème :

Merci de votre aide

en regardant dans les log l email est bien envoyé mais est bloqué car il ne reconnait pas destinataire postfix le bloque


J’ai trouvé la solution pour la confirmation du mail. Vous pouvez la voir sur mon post :